The Botanical Garden of Keimyung University is often a mesmerizing sanctuary for nature fans visiting Daegu. The backyard garden offers a various collection of plant species, together with unusual and unique crops from all over the world. Website visitors normally takes leisurely strolls along the effectively-preserved paths, getting themed gardens, tranquil ponds, and academic displays.

For more than fifty several years, Daegu has become the only real place in Korea the place rice and soup tend to be eaten independently, whereas other areas customarily combine their rice and soup jointly. In Korean, "ttaro" indicates "separate" and "gukbap" implies "soup and rice". In case you have a flavor for procuring (As well as in Korea, that is a necessity), Seomun Sector is the very first spot you'll be wanting to go.
